If you run, jot down the mileage of your running shoes. Over the shoes’ lifetime, these shoes will take a lot of abuse. After 400 miles, the time has come to buy a new pair. Log your mileage to ensure that you replace your running shoes in a timely manner.

Don’t go shoe shopping first thing in the morning. Feet can swell throughout the day. Early evening or late afternoon is a perfect time for shoe shopping. By doing this, your new shoes are more likely to fit comfortably throughout the day.

If you are shoe shopping for a toddler, stability is important. As toddlers begin walking, they need study shoes to keep them from getting hurt. Tennis shoes are best for toddlers. Stay away from shoes with slick bottoms as they are more likely to result in slips and falls.
